Monte Olmi is the name of this vineyard, located in Pedemonte di Valpolicella in the heart of Valpolicella Classica. The vineyard is terraced to ensure efficient drainage in case of heavy rainfall. At the same time, the depth and clay in the soil serve to retain water during the dry season. Since the early 60s, Renzo Tedeschi had the idea to vinify the grapes from the Monte Olmi vineyard separately, thus creating one of the first single vineyard wines in Valpolicella. Today Monte Olmi is the symbol of the estate and its territory.
Its color is intense ruby and its aromas are reminiscent of blackberries, spices and flowers combined with notes of Slavonian oak. In the mouth it is full, peppery, fruity, with moderate tannins and a fine aftertaste. The aftertaste confirms its floral character and is persistent. It is a suitable wine for aging which you can enjoy with red meat, game and aged cheeses.
The "Finca El Grajo Viejo" (old vineyard), is strategically located at the foot of the Manvirgo hill between Anguix & Roa, at an altitude of 815 meters and facing south. The Seleccion El Grajo Viejo (single vineyard) is the cream of Protos wines. Produced from 100% Tinta del Pais from a single 70 year old vineyard. Alcoholic fermentation takes place in 500 liter French barrels at a controlled temperature and is then left to mature for 18 months in new French barrels and 12 months in the bottles.
It has a deep purple color with purple hues and is an elegant wine, with good aromatic range and great complexity. More specifically, the aromatic bouquet consists of extremely ripe black fruits, mocha, spices and finally some balsamic and mineral notes. In the mouth it is delicious full bodied but with fine and elegant tannins, with the acidity of the vines grown on poor land bringing the balance. Long, pleasant, slightly salty and persistent finish and great aging potential due to its structured tannins and noble acidity. Enjoy it with roast pork, red meat, chorizos, foie gras and mature cheeses.
